Anderson DIAZ Elizabeth, N.J. Center So. w 6-3 w 245 62 One of a handful of true freshman to see action for Monmouth in 2000... Will be vying for playing time on the offensive line. 2000 (Freshman): Played in four games as a true freshman... Served as a backup center behind veteran Mark Di Pisa. High School: Two-sport standout at Elizabeth (N.J.) High School... Lettered three seasons in football... Led team to a pair of state titles in 1997 and 1999... Team posted a 30-5 record from 1997 to 1999... Tabbed second-team all- county as a senior... Earned three letters in track and field throwing the shot, discus and javelin... Helped track team to state titles in 1998 and 2000. Personal: Son of Jose and Consuelo Diaz... Born January 1, 1982 in New York City... Majoring in communications.
